// LocatedRect.java // // A LocatedRect is a rectangle with a location in // space (unlike a Rectangle which has only a height and width) // public class LocatedRect extends Rectangle { private double xL, yL; // lower left hand corner. public LocatedRect() { // Constructor setCorner(0.0, 0.0); } public LocatedRect(double x1, double x2, double y1, double y2) { // Constructor super(x2-x1,y2-y1); // Calls constructor for Rectangle xL=x1; yL=y1; } public void setCorner(double xa, double ya) { // Setter xL=xa; yL=ya; } public double right() { return xL+xSpan; } // Getters public double left() { return xL; } public double top() { return yL+ySpan; } public double bottom() { return yL; } public String toString() { return "LR[" + left() + ", " + right() + ". " + bottom() + ", " + top() + "]"; } // toString() gives a printable format. Note this overrides // the toString() method in Rectangle. // translateDest is a destructive form of translation. public LocatedRect translateDest(double dx, double dy) { setCorner(left()+dx,bottom()+dy); return this; } // translateoNonDest is a destructive form of translation. public LocatedRect translateNonDest(double dx, double dy) { return new LocatedRect(left()+dx, right()+dx, bottom()+dy, top()+dy); } } // end LocatedRect
